THE HORIZONTAL MILLING MACHINE
V. Ryan © 2003 - 2022
 
The Horizontal Milling Machine is a very robust and sturdy machine. A variety of cutters are available to removed/shape material that is normally held in a strong machine vice. This horizontal miller is used when a vertical miller is less suitable. For instance, if a lot of material has to be removed by the cutters or there is less of a need for accuracy - a horizontal milling machine is chosen.

  The cutter can be changed very easily. The arbor bracket is removed by loosening nuts and bolts that hold the arbor firmly in position. The arbor can be slid off the over arm. The spacers are then removed as well as the original cutter. The new cutter is placed in position, spacers slid back onto the arbor and the arbor bracket tightened back in position.
